Bad Points: It has no scent, which can be seen as a good or a bad thing, depending on your preference. I quite like scented moisturisers but unfortunately I'm prone to spots and scents don't seem to help so I tend to avoid them.
General comments: Simple Regeneration Moisturiser has a light texture and absorbs easily without 'dragging' your skin, and doesn't leave a shine on yor face. I'm also pleased to reports that it hasn't given me any spots after three weeks of using it, which is good going as most moisturizers I try do. It makes a great base for foundation, and it's good that it has SPF built-in because I'm too lazy / forgetful to apply moisturizer *and* separate SPF...
I'd recommend this to others, and I'd buy it again!

I really like Simple Regeneration Moisturiser. I have very sensitive skin and this is one of the few moisturisers that does not irritate it or cause dry patches. It has a good SPF 15 and no overpowering fragrance. It's a great base for foundation and it absorbs easily.- Read hannelore's review (91 words)
